FT.WORTH, Texas - The Tulane (5-3) volleyball team dropped its evening match to TCU (6-5) 3-0. The game scores were 14-16, 3-15 and 11-15. The Wave went 0-2 on the day.
TCU's strong defense shut down the Wave, as the Horned Frogs recorded 13 team blocks to Tulane's three.
Tulane freshman Kim Swafford recorded a team high nine kills. TCU's Amy Atamanczuk put down a match high 17 kills.
Despite 20 kills from senior Sentmore, the Tulane volleyball team fell to Montana State (7-1) 3-1 in the first match on the TCU Volleyball Invitational on Friday. The game scores were 15-9, 6-15, 7-15 and 16-18.
The Wave trailed the Bobcats 6-0 in the first game and battled their way to an 8-7 lead. TU went on a 7-2 scoring run and took game one 15-9. Lindsey Bennett had an errorless first game, recording six kills. Montana State got revenge in game two as they out hit the Green Wave .263 to .100 and evened the score at one game each. MSU's momentum carried them to victory with a 15-7 win of game three and an 18-16 edging in game four.
Leading the Wave was Sentmore who tallied 20 kills and eight digs. Swafford had a career high 17 kills and seven blocks. Freshman Lauren Jones-McClain had a double-double performance with 15 kills and 10 digs. Karlyn Daly made her Green Wave debut and chalked 12 digs.
Anne Watts and Karin Lundqvist led the Bobcats to victory. Watts recorded 19 kills and 10 digs, while Lundqvist posted 15 kills and 12 digs. Montana State had a strong defensive showing, out blocking the Wave 18 to12 total team blocks. Julia Handwerk had a match high 12 blocks.
